Ornamental Grasses
Height: 4 - 5 ft Spread: 2 ft
Light: Full sun Zone: 5 - 8
This selection has deep green leaves with a wide
white stripe down the center. The variegation
remains distinctively appealing throughout the
growing season. Has a distinctly upright and
clumping habit.
Avalanche Feather Reed Grass
Calamagrostis acutiflora ‘Avalanche’
Height: 4 - 5 ft Spread: 2 ft
Light: Full sun Zone: 5 - 8
The narrow, green leaves have a bright gold
center which radiates out in the sunlight. At-
tractive tan wheat-like seed heads appear in
early summer and last all season long.
Eldorado Feather Reed Grass
Calamagrostis acutiflora ‘Eldorado’
Height: 22” Spread: 16 - 20”
Light: Full sun Zone: 4 - 8
A cool season, clumping grass with a compact,
erect growth habit. Wheat-like seed heads ap-
pear in late spring and last all season long. A
good choice for heavy clay soils.
Karl Foerster Feather Reed Grass
Calamagrostis acutiflora ‘Karl Foerster’
Height: 2 - 5 ft Spread: 1 - 2 ft
Light: Full sun Zone: 5 - 8
Variegated foliage that starts out with bright
creamy-white margins which then fad to white
with a pink flush. In late spring, strikingly
erect, feathery plumes will appear, reaching up
to 5 ft tall.
Overdam Feather Reed Grass
Calamagrostis acutiflora ‘Overdam’
Height: 2 - 3 ft Spread: 2 - 3 ft
Light: Part shade Zone: 5 - 8
Bright gold foliage with thin green margins. It
is an excellent choice as a highlight plant for a
shade or water garden. A moisture loving grass
that needs to be constantly wet or moist to
thrive. It will grow in shallow water and looks
great around a pond with blue hostas.
Bowles Golden Sedge
Carex elata ‘Bowles Golden’
Height: 12 - 18” Spread: 12 - 18”
Light: Part to full shade Zone: 5 - 9
Features attractive blue-green foliage. Insignifi-
cant greenish-white flowers appear in summer.
Plant in masses for a splendid effect.
Blue Zinger Sedge
Carex glauca ‘Blue Zinger’
Height: 12” Spread: 18”
Light: Part shade Zone: 5 - 9
One of the most popular variegated sedges, this
selection has creamy-yellow leaves with deep
green margins. They cascade softly to the
ground in a fountain-like manner. Unlike many
other sedges, this one prefers dry to average soil
moisture.
Evergold Sedge
Carex hachijoensis ‘Evergold’
Height: 22” Spread: 16 - 20”
Light: Full sun Zone: 4 - 8
A clumping grass that is treasured for its showy,
drooping flowers and unique bamboo-like foli-
age. Its tendency to reseed makes it an ideal
choice for mass plantings. The seed heads also
make interesting cut flowers.
Northern Sea Oats
Chasmanthium latifolium
Height: 8 - 10 ft Spread: 3 - 4 ft
Light: Full sun Zone: 6 - 10
Forms large dense clumps of stiff, narrow
leaves. Best known for its silky pink plumes
that appear in late summer and last through the
winter. Requires minimal care and has very
sharp blade edges.
Pink Pampas Grass
Cortaderia selloana ‘Pink’
Height: 4 - 5 ft Spread: 3 - 4 ft
Light: Full sun Zone: 5 - 10
One of the most cold hardy varieties of pampas
grass, it is shorter and more compact that the
others. It bears the same showy, medium-sized
plumes which are silvery-cream and feel silky to
the touch.
Dwarf Pampas Grass
Cortaderia selloana ‘Pumila’
